Product description

If you want to keep edges neat and weeds under control without dragging out a mower, a cordless strimmer is usually the most convenient route. This Metal Blade cordless strimmer leans into that “grab it and tidy up” idea, with a removable, adjustable setup that should make corners and borders feel less fiddly.

That said, it’s not going to replace a proper lawn mower for big, long-grass jobs. It’s more about finishing the look—quick trim sessions, garden edges, and light-to-moderate weeding where a cable would get annoying.

The essentials

This cordless grass trimmer is built around a 21V lithium-ion battery and a brushless motor (described as a 650W pure copper brushless motor). The manufacturer positions it as quieter and lower-vibration than more traditional noisy, vibration-heavy strimmers—so on paper it’s a better fit for residential areas where you’d rather not feel like you’re firing up a small workshop.

Cutting-wise, it’s aimed at trimming grass and weeds with a 15cm cutting diameter and a “metal blade” approach with 27 blades. The package is also described as containing what you need to get started, plus customer support.

What stands out in day-to-day use

The most practical differentiator here is the versatility in how you can move and angle the tool. The description mentions removable wheels: with the wheels attached you can push it for more efficient weeding (useful when you’re covering a bit of ground in a straight line). If you remove the wheels, you get more control over the angle of the cutting head, which should help when you’re trying to get close to borders, pathways, and awkward corners.

A micro example: imagine you’ve just cut the lawn and there are a few stubborn patches along a paving edge. You can set it up without the wheels, tilt the head to follow the line, and do a couple of short passes to clean up before the whole garden looks “finished”.

Battery runtime and expectations

The battery is described as a high-capacity 21V lithium-ion unit with a stated runtime of around 40–60 minutes. In real life, runtime often depends on how hard you’re asking it to work—thicker growth and longer sessions can shorten that window.

Also, the tool is cordless, which is its main advantage: you avoid the constant cable management. But cordless tools can only do so much before you need to recharge, so if you’re planning long, uninterrupted sessions, you’ll want to be a bit realistic about battery management.

Noise and comfort: quieter, but check your tolerance

The manufacturer explicitly calls out “whisper-quiet” performance and lower noise, paired with a brushless motor design. That’s a nice selling point if you’re gardening at times when you’d rather not disturb neighbours.

Still, “quiet” is relative. If you’re sensitive to sound or you’re used to the feel of different power tools, it’s worth considering that any strimmer will make some noise when running, and your comfort will also depend on how you hold it and how often you’re switching between short trimming bursts.

Key specifications

  • Name: Metal Blade Cordless Strimmer (21V)
  • Type: Cordless grass/weed trimmer (retractable handle)
  • Battery: 21V lithium-ion
  • Motor: 650W pure copper brushless motor (as described)
  • Runtime: 40–60 minutes (as stated)
  • Cutting diameter: 15cm
  • Blades: 27 blades

Final verdict

It makes sense to buy this Metal Blade cordless strimmer if your main goal is tidy garden edges and weeding without the hassle of a cable. The wheel/no-wheel setup is especially relevant if you want the option to push for faster clearing, but still adjust the angle when you’re working around corners.

It’s not the best choice if you expect it to handle heavy, overgrown grass like a mower would, or if you want one tool to cover very large areas in a single session without thinking about battery time. Not having more detail in the description (for example on how it performs in different grass thicknesses) means you should treat it as a practical cordless trimmer for regular garden maintenance rather than a “power through anything” machine.
